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54 746029 2886750184 15 755
468 423 31730867264
468 423 31730867264
15642 32 168796827
All about undefined
Interested in learning more?
468 423 31730867264
15642 32 168796827
See more
0258447 44433437 2790
05193096617 21546445034 0047114
See more
3444021 13627051
898 958133 99216 787 37827223
See more